Welcome to TechNet Blogs Sign in | Join | Help

Browse by Tags

All Tags » Virtual Server   (RSS)

Вышел Microsoft System Center Data Protection Manager (SC DPM) 2007 Service Pack 1 — централизованное резервное копирование виртуальных машин Hyper-V

Позволю себе вклиниться перед рассказом Алекса об Operations Manager и поделиться краткой новостью (она действительно краткая — практически весь объём заметки занимают ссылки). Речь пойдёт про другой продукт семейства System Center, который предназначен для централизованного резервного копирования, — Data Protection Manager (DPM) 2007. На днях для него вышел первый пакет обновления (Service Pack 1), сборка 2.0.8793.0. И это стало, в общем-то, весьма долгожданным событием. Дело в том, что помимо традиционного для любых обновлений исправления ошибок, этот пакет добавляет в продукт сразу несколько очень важных новых возможностей. Самой главной для нас, конечно же, является полная поддержка виртуальных машин Hyper-V.

Тема виртуализации на «Платформе-2009»

Наверное, не для кого уже не секрет, что главное ежегодное мероприятие Microsoft в России, которое называется «Платформа», состоится в четверг и пятницу на этой неделе. Расписание конференции, разумеется, было опубликовано зарание — и мы настоятельно рекомендуем ознакомиться с ним всех читателей блога. Конечно же, мы надеемся, что среди вас много таких, кто сможет принять личное участие в мероприятии. Но даже если это не так — вы всё равно сможете ознакомиться с содержанием всех докладов. Ведь они будут записываться на видео и станут доступны для бесплатного просмотра прямо на сайте конференции. Более того, церемония открытия и пленарный доклад будут транслироваться в прямом эфире — в четверг с 10 до 12 утра.

Удаление VMAdditions из Hyper-V

Мы уже разговаривали о совместимости виртуальных машин между различными платформами виртуализации Microsoft. Очевидно, что большинство задач переноса ВМ касаются перехода на Hyper-V. Обычно вы без проблем можете создать новую виртуальную машину в Hyper-V и подключить к ней виртуальный диск с ОС, установленной под Virtual Server 2005. При этом часто пропускается такой важный момент, как предварительное удаление Virtual Machine Additions. В результате вы не сможете установить Integration Services, так как установлены VM Additions (проверка осуществляется по наличию службы 1-vmsrvc). Казалось бы, перед вами тривиальная задача, — достаточно удалить VM Additions, и можно будет установить службы интеграции. Но тут-то и появляется проблема. В виртуальной машине, запущенной под Hyper-V, вы сможете удалить VM Additions только начиная от версии 13.813, которая поставлялась с Virtual Server 2005 R2 SP1. Предыдущие версии VM Additions отказываются удаляться будучи запущенными в «не родной» системе виртуализации. Если ваша виртуальная машина создавалась в более ранеей версии Virtual Server или Virtual PC, и вы не обновляли VM Additions в ней, то подключив такой виртуальный диск к виртуальной машине Hyper-V, вы просто не сможете удалить VM Additions штатным образом. Придется устанавливать Virtual Server 2005 или Virtual PC, загружать ВМ в этой платформе, удалять VMAdditions, а только затем возвращать виртуальный диск в Hyper-V и устанавливать службы интеграции. Но есть и обходной путь, который устраняет необходимость этого шага.

Обновление 956124 для Virtual Server 2005 - работа VHDmount

Казалось бы, не так давно вышла версия Virtual Server 2005, поддерживающая Windows Vista SP1, XP SP3 и Server 2008. Сразу же начали появляться сообщения о том, что иногда после установки обновления начинаются проблемы с подключением виртуальных дисков при помощи утилиты VHDMount. Я уже описывал способ решения таких проблем. Однако время шло, и наличие известного способа восстановления работы VHDmount не уменьшало потока обращений от тех, у кого что-то работало не так. Это привело к выходу нового кумулятивного обновления 956124 для Virtual Server 2005 R2 SP1, которе устраняет описанные проблемы.

Выпущен VMC to Hyper-V Import tool

Я уже писал ранее о том, что автор VRMCPlus ведет разработку утилиты, импортирующей настройки виртуальных машин из Virtual Server 2005 в Hyper-V. После пары месяцев внутреннего тестирования утилита увидела свет. Итак, чего же позволяет делать «VMC to Hyper-V Import Tool»? Основная задача утилиты, как видно из названия, — это импорт конфигурации виртуальных машин из VS2005 в Hyper-V. К релизу автор подготовил сюрприз — поддержку Virtual PC 2007. Благо, формат файла конфигурации виртуальной машины (*.vmc) в ней отличается от VS2005 совсем незначительно.

Hyper-V Constrained Delegation of Authority — или как подключить образы компакт-диска с другого сервера или разместить виртуальные диски на сетевом ресурсе

Я думаю, что многие из вас уже пробовали подключить к виртуальному компакт-диску ВМ образ в формате ISO, который лежит на неком файловом сервере. Или может вы пробовали подключить к виртуальный диск в формате VHD, находящийся на удаленном сервере, а не локальном диске? Ведь благодаря SMB 2.0 производительность сети в Windows Server 2008 значительно увеличилась — и особенно это заметно при доступе к крупным файлам. Так или иначе, вне зависимости от того, используете вы Hyper-V, Virtual Server 2005 или даже какое-то стороннее решение виртуализации (при условии, что оно запускается не как приложение пользователя, а как служба ОС), задачу подключения дисков к ВМ по сети вы сразу выполнить не сможете. Причина конечно же известна — службы работают в контексте учетной записи «Local System», которая не всегда имеет права доступа к сетевым ресурсам. В Базе знаний Microsoft есть несколько статьей, посвященных этой проблеме. Сегодня мы детально разберемся в нем, чтобы более вопросов не возникало. Я буду описывать подход для Windows Server 2008 и Hyper-V — но имейте в виду, что для Windows XP/2003/Vista и Virtual Server 2005 все делается аналогично. Причем оговорюсь сразу — я описываю только поддерживаемый Microsoft способ с использованием Constrained Delegation, а не манипуляции с выдачей прав на различные объекты учетным записям компьютеров.

VMC to Hyper-V migration tool от автора VRMCPlus

Я уже писал о совместимости виртуальных машин VPC/VS2005 и Hyper-V и о шагах, требуемых для переноса виртуальной машины. По минимуму вам потребуется вручную создать новую ВМ в Hyper-V, предоставить ей необходимые ресурсы (процессоры, память, сетевые адаптеры, дисковые контроллеры, CD-ROM, дисководы,..), изменить настройки BIOS, подключить оригинальный виртуальный диск формата VHD к виртуальному IDE контроллеру, и лишь после вы сможете загрузить данную ВМ в Hyper-V. Если вы попробуете сделать это с несколькими десятками виртуальных машин, то поймете, насколько это может быть утомительно. Matthijs ten Seldam, автор VRMCPlus начал новый проект, - утилиту импортирующую в Hyper-V виртуальные машины Viirtual PC / Virtual Server 2005.

Окончательный выпуск Offline Virtual Machine Servicing Tool

Некоторое время назад мы уже подробно описывали Offline Virtual Machine Servicing Tool. Напомню вкратце, что это бесплатный набор инструментов и документации (так называемый Solution Accelerator), предназначенный для поддержания виртуальных машин в соответствии с требованиями к установке обновлений ПО. В качестве источника обновлений используется либо WSUS, либо System Center Configuration Manager. В случае необходимости, OVMST сам запустит выключенные или приостановленные ВМ, инициирует установку обновлений, а затем вернёт ВМ в исходное состояние.

Проблемы с подключением дисков при помощи VHDmount.exe после установки обновления 948515 на Virtual Server 2005 R2 SP1

В середине мая для Virtual Server 2005 стало доступно обновление 948515, обеспечившее поддержку новых ОС на «родительском» сервере и в виртуальных машинах. Однако, не все оказалось идеально с данным обновлением. На некоторых системах замечены проблемы с подключением VHD дисков при помощи утилиты VHDMount.exe. Примером проблемы может являться появление ошибки: The specified operation could not be completed as an unexpected error has occurred. при выполнении команд vhdmount /m vhd file или vhdmount /p vhd file.
Posted by Alex A. | 1 Comments
Filed under: , ,

Вышел Microsoft Assessment and Planning Toolkit Solution Accelerator (MAP) 3.1

Совсем недавно мы писали о публичной бета-версии MAP 3.1. И вот вчера этот продукт стал доступен в окончательной версии. Полный список нововведений опубликован в предыдущей заметке — а здесь просто упомняну, что нас, конечно, интересуют две особенности.

Microsoft Assessment and Planning Toolkit 3.1 Beta

На праздниках стала доступна предварительная версия Microsoft Assessment and Planning Toolkit 3.1. Если вас интересует возможность обновления ОС на серверах до Windows Server 2008 или целесообразности установки Windows Vista на рабочих станциях, если вам важно, какие серверные роли, антивирусные средства или настройки Windows Firewall присутствуют на ваших серверах и рабочих станциях, если вы заинтересованы в консолидации серверов или приложений при помощи Hyper-V, VS2005 или SoftGrid, то Microsoft Assessment and Planning — это то, что вам нужно.

VRMCPlus 1.8.0 на Download Center

Сегодня утилита VRMCPlus обновилась до версии 1.8.0. Основное нововведение — поддержка обновления KB948515 для Virtual Server 2005 R2 SP1. Изначально предполагалось, что файлы этого обновления будет иметь номер сборки 1.1.627.0. Однако в последний момент перед официальной публикацией команда Virtual Server изменила номер сборки на 1.1.629.0. Поэтому предыдущая версия VRMCPlus 1.7.0, рассчитывающая именно на сборку 1.1.627.0, при подключении к обновленному Virtual Server выдает предупреждение о неподдерживаемой конфигурации. В версии 1.8.0 это исправлено.

О поддержке продуктов Microsoft в виртуальных машинах

Разных заказчиков интересуют разные вопросы, но один из них всегда остается в первой тройке. Это вопрос о поддержке ОС и ПО Microsoft в средах виртуализации — Virtual PC, Virtual Server 2005, Hyper-V и платформах третьих фирм. Вопрос достаточно тонкий и сложный, но очень важный для клиентов. Давайте в нем попробуем разобраться.

Диски с отменой (Undo) и Hyper-V

Многие из тех, кто работал в Virtual Server 2005 или Virtual PC, часто пользовались функционалом дисков с отменой (undo). Это давало возможность при выключении виртуальной машины вернуть ее в то состояние, в котором она находилась до включения. Помимо этого, изменения можно было сохранить до следующего включения или применить их к основному виртуальному диску навсегда. В Hyper-V такая возможность отсутствует. И я часто слышу вопрос — как же теперь отменять или применять изменения. Ответ на этот вопрос очевиден: в Hyper-V существует механизм снимков (snapshots), о котором я уже писал. Он позволяет значительно расширить сценарии применения дисков с отменой, так как появилась возможность строить несколько независимых деревьев снимков. Но сейчас я расскажу о том, как использовать механизм снимков Hyper-V аналогично использованию дисков с отменой в Virtual Server 2005.
Posted by Alex A. | 0 Comments

Определение платформы виртуализации из сценария

Недавно мне понадобился способ, позволяющий отличать виртуальные машины Virtual Server 2005 от виртуальных машин Hyper-V при применении групповых политик. Также возможна ситуация, когда понадобится определить платформу виртуализации для установки программного обеспечения — например, для обновления компонент виртуализации. Возможность узнать из виртуальной машины, какая используется платформа виртуализации, также может потребоваться для задач инвентаризации. Например, в тех сценариях, когда «родительская» система» по соображениям безопасности не включена в домен или даже не имеет доступа в корпоративную сеть. (При этом сеть может быть доступна лишь из самих виртуальных машин). Многие ли из вас помнят наизусть, какие платформы виртуализации используются на тех или иных серверах вашей сети (считая, что их много)? Какая версия Hyper-V, актуальна ли версия Virtual Server 2005 (R2, R2 SP1…), установлены ли в виртуальной машине текущие компоненты интеграции Hyper-V или Virtual Machine Additions (для VS2005)? В принципе, ничто не мешает нам определять и сторонние платформы виртуализации — как и версии используемых ими компонентов.
Posted by Alex A. | 4 Comments
Attachment(s): DefineVM_BIOS.vbs
More Posts Next page »
 
Page view tracker